Yep, that looks fine, and if you only want to see match odds markets by the time you add more fixtures then sort them you'll have everything you need next to each fixture

You could then create a shortcut key to take you to the next market within that event (fixture)
So you could select a MO market then press your shortcut key and be taken to the CS market for that fixture (no matter where it is in your guardian list), then press again to go to the O/U market, then again to return back to you MO market
